Output 41d2638b780e9c0da35973bd4a0fc7576e260f61f5759173013a7bed264e8321:1
- value
- 1107950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8695bb688ce6fae6cb9670eedefe72efbd3e1acd OP_EQUAL
- address
- 3DxdqpEgQ24oSLA9N1CPWX8HtzhA8Ho33v
- transaction
- 41d2638b780e9c0da35973bd4a0fc7576e260f61f5759173013a7bed264e8321
- confirmations
- 332641
- spent
- true